@article{oai:u-ryukyu.repo.nii.ac.jp:02016342, author = {外間, 政哲 and Hokama, Seitetsu}, issue = {1}, journal = {琉球大学保健学医学雑誌=Ryukyu University Journal of Health Sciences and Medicine}, note = {It is now generally accepted that distribution of species of atypical mycobacteria varies geographically. While ecology and epidemiology of the atypical mycobacteria of mainland Japan have been relatively well investigated, those of Okinawa, which is located in the semi-tropical zone, have rarely been studied. Since 1971, this author has been investigating atypical mycobacterioses in Okinawa, and has found six cases of atypical mycobacterioses. Bacteriological studies on the acid fast bacilli isolated from the patients of these six cases showed that three strains were M. intracellulare and the other three were M. scroflaceum. During the clinical observations of ralatively long periods, a moderate improvement was seen in two cases, and a slight improvement in two other cases, and worsening was seen in the last two., 論文}, pages = {52--58}, title = {[原著]沖縄における非定型抗酸菌症 : 細菌学的研究と臨床}, volume = {1} }
